From 9f4db9f1b43c29203fd583f4086c48b94f497950 Mon Sep 17 00:00:00 2001 From: Minijackson Date: Fri, 28 Apr 2023 00:04:02 +0200 Subject: vim: use diffopt linematch:60 set EDITOR and related as normal profile var --- common/vim.nix | 2 +- dotfiles/vim/lua/myConfig.lua | 5 +++--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/common/vim.nix b/common/vim.nix index 89d28b7..e6c0ab8 100644 --- a/common/vim.nix +++ b/common/vim.nix @@ -198,7 +198,7 @@ in { vale ]; - environment.sessionVariables = { + environment.variables = { EDITOR = "nvim"; MANPAGER = "nvim +Man!"; NEOVIDE_MULTIGRID = "true"; diff --git a/dotfiles/vim/lua/myConfig.lua b/dotfiles/vim/lua/myConfig.lua index 4411d8c..df1fb64 100644 --- a/dotfiles/vim/lua/myConfig.lua +++ b/dotfiles/vim/lua/myConfig.lua @@ -5,8 +5,11 @@ vim.o.undofile = true vim.o.backup = true vim.opt.backupdir:remove "." +vim.opt.shortmess:append "A" vim.opt.shortmess:append "c" +vim.opt.diffopt:append "linematch:60" + vim.o.mouse = "a" vim.o.ignorecase = true @@ -21,8 +24,6 @@ vim.o.cindent = true vim.o.tabstop = 4 vim.o.shiftwidth = 4 -vim.opt.shortmess:append "A" - vim.o.inccommand = "split" vim.o.scrolloff = 1 -- cgit v1.2.3